Boat-tailed Grackle. Scientific name: Quiscalus major. Bigger than the Common Grackle, the Boat-tailed Grackle is best identified by its long tail that has a broad end resembling a spatula. Similar to other grackles, the tail is often folded in the shape of a keel, with the tail margins held higher than the center.

Agelaius phoeniceus. Length: 6.7-9.1 in (17-23 cm) Weight: 1.1-2.7 oz (32-77 g) Wingspan: 12.2-15.8 in (31-40 cm) Red-winged Blackbirds remain all year in the lower 48 and the Pacific Coast of British Columbia. Those that breed in Canada and some of the north of the lower 48 migrate south for the winter.

Length 24-25cm. Habitats Woodland, Urban and Suburban, Farmland, Grassland. UK breeding birds 5,100,000 pairs. UK wintering 10-15 million birds. Weight 80-100g. Wingspan 34-38.5cm. While male blackbirds live up to their name, confusingly, females are actually brown, often with spots and streaks on their breasts. Find out more.

Baby blackbirds grow exceptionally quickly, obtaining around 50 to 60% of their adult body weight in the first ten days. Fluffy, downy feathers begin to grow after a couple of days, giving a 7-day-old nestling blackbird a somewhat round or rotund appearance. Discover vibrant tanager bird species to know. PaulReevesPhotography/Getty Images Rusty Blackbird In fall, you can see the rusty brown plumage (above) that gives this bird its name. The buff colored eyebrow is another key field mark. During other seasons, male rusty blackbirds are a dull black color with yellow eyes.

A bird to be seen in the full sun, the male Brewer's Blackbird is a glossy, almost liquid combination of black, midnight blue, and metallic green. Females are a staid brown, without the male's bright eye or the female Red-winged Blackbird's streaks.
